COMICS: Moon Knight Relaunch in 2011

COMICS: Moon Knight Relaunch in 2011

Moon Knight had a debut in august 1975 in a comic book called Werewolf by Night #23 - written by Doug Moench with art by Don Perlin. Now it's getting a facelift.

As in the time was proved popular by readers but not too much like the super heroes we know today

The Moon Knight has appeared in the story lines of 2099 ,S.H.I.E.L.D, House of M, Marvel Zombies, Ultimate, and Universe X



Now on to the new's... It was announced at the New York Comic Con that 2011 will see the launch of a new Moon Knight series by Brian Michael Bendis and Alex Maleev, which Bendis has described as a "complete reinvention of the character on every conceivable level".
